Bulgaria Road Agency Director Dismissed over Lack of Leadership

Bulgaria's Minister of Regional Development and Public Works, Rosen Plevneliev, dismissed the Road Agency Director over lack of leadership skills. Photo by BGNES

The Director of Bulgaria's Road Agency, Dimitar Ivanov, was released from his duties Wednesday.

The information was announced by the Minister of Regional Development and Public Works, Rosen Plevneliev, who said he dismissed Ivanov after the deadline for his resignation's submission expired Tuesday.

Plevneliev says he received information from Brussels that Ivanov has made efforts to change the EU funds abuse and mismanagement at the Agency and his dismissal was not due to lack of competency or good will to conduct honest public tenders.

“The problem here is leadership. We need to make decisions in the right direction with a strong hand,” Plevneliev is quoted as saying.

 Bulgaria's Prime Minister, Boyko Borisov appointed Dimitar Ivanov as Director of the Agency at the end of July. Ivanov was the head of the Roads Agency in August-October 2008 after the institution was shaken by a corruption scandal in the beginning of 2008. At the time Ivanov resigned over health issues.
